On the geometry of metallic pseudo-Riemannian structures [PDF]

open access: yesRivista di Matematica della Universit\`a di Parma, vol. 11, no. 1, 2020, (69-87), 2018
We generalize the notion of metallic structure in the pseudo-Riemannian setting, define the metallic Norden structure and study its integrability. We consider metallic maps between metallic manifolds and give conditions under which they are constant. We also construct a metallic natural connection recovering as particular case the Ganchev and Mihova ...

Spatially Resolved Metal Loss from M31 [PDF]

open access: yes, 2018
As galaxies evolve, they must enrich and exchange gas with the surrounding medium, but the timing of these processes and how much gas is involved remain poorly understood. In this work, we leverage metals as tracers of past gas flows to constrain the history of metal ejection and redistribution in M31.
